Deciding when to modernize your home’s electrical system is a critical safety step for any homeowner. In our experience completing over 6,000 projects across Southern California, we recommend considering an Electric Panel Upgrade if you notice specific warning signs or are planning major home additions.
Key indicators that you may need an upgrade in your Thousand Oaks home include:
- Frequent circuit breaker trips: If your breakers often flip when using standard appliances, your current panel likely cannot handle the electrical load.
- Signs of electrical hazards: Sparking outlets, burning odors, or flickering lights are serious red flags that require immediate attention from a licensed technician.
- Modern upgrades: If you are planning an EV/Tesla Charger Installation or adding high-demand appliances, your system may need increased amperage to remain code-compliant and safe.
- Age of the home: For older properties, outdated panels may not meet current California Contractor License Board or local Thousand Oaks building codes.
